That error has nothing to do with your problem.

Describe your system and player - "unable to play filetype" usually
means your player cannot play AAC and LMS is unable to transcode due to
wrong setting or faad not being available. This is probably a general
problem on your system not a BBCiPlayer problem.

If it is really a BBCiplayer 1.5.2 problem - please post on the thread
for BBCPlayer 1.5.2.

Re: [SlimDevices: Plugins] Spotify with synced players

2016-12-25 Thread elektronaut0815

I had the same problem and got it solved by removing the Spotify
Protocol Handler Plugin. Only using SB Radio and Touch(es), so I didn't
need the plugin anyway...
The official plugin works great on it's own!
